Meanwhile, the black unemployment rate is at the highest in more than a decade

George Floyd would be pleased with the strong U.S. jobs data released Friday, President Donald Trump said, invoking the memory of the black man who died in police custody and looking past African American unemployment at the highest in more than a decade.

Trump also called it a “great, great day in terms of equality.” It’s not clear what he was talking about. While overall unemployment improved in May, the rate for African Americans ticked up to 16.8 per cent. Trump has grappled with how to respond to Floyd’s death — he’s condemned it and the officers involved, but also tried to snuff out protests demanding justice, police accountability and action to address racial inequality. Trump has no plans to attend Floyd’s funeral Tuesday in Houston.— Donald J. Trump June 5, 2020Trump has threatened to deploy active-duty forces to combat protesters in U.S. cities, drawing rebukes from political leaders in both parties.

Trump’s approval rating has slipped 2.5 points in the week and a half since Floyd died in the custody of a Minneapolis police officer who knelt into his neck for nine minutes.
